Is Kaws a Good Investment

Is Kaws a good investment? The answer depends on factors like the specific artwork, its provenance, and market trends. Kaws pieces have historically appreciated in value, particularly limited editions and unique works. The artist’s popularity, branding, and collaborations have contributed to the demand for his art. However, the art market is subject to fluctuations, and an investment in any artwork carries risks. Factors to consider include the artist’s reputation, scarcity of the artwork, and its potential for appreciation over time.

Artist’s Reputation

Kaws has achieved significant recognition in the contemporary art world, with his work featured in prestigious museums and institutions worldwide, including the Brooklyn Museum, the Museum of Contemporary Art in Los Angeles, and the Fondation Cartier pour l’art contemporain in Paris. He has collaborated with renowned brands such as Nike, Uniqlo, and Supreme, further enhancing his visibility and appeal.

Investment Strategies

Investing in Kaws can be a lucrative decision, but it’s crucial to develop a sound investment strategy. Here are some effective strategies to consider:

  • Long-term holdings: Acquiring Kaws artworks and holding them for a substantial period can yield greater returns, as their value tends to appreciate over time.
  • Diversification: Spread your investment across various Kaws artworks, including paintings, sculptures, collectibles, and street art, to reduce risk and enhance portfolio stability.
  • Research and due diligence: Thoroughly research the artist, his works, and the art market before making any investment decision.
